Manatee Springs State Park

Image
We left Seacrest beach Saturday with the others and headed towards Manatee Springs State Park. We spent one night along the way and a funky little RV park in Panacea, FL. We arrived at Manatee Springs on Sunday after noon and set up in the great little campground with plenty of room between campsites. Monday we went for a hike through the surrounding forest and Tuesday we did a 9 1/2 mile canoe trip down the Suwannee River. Click here to see many more photos.
